# Tollgate Consent Banner — Environments

The Tollgate consent banner rolls out across three environments: sandbox, preview, and production. Sandbox disables consent persistence entirely; preview stores choices in Varnholt-region storage only; production enforces regional residency. Reviewers should confirm that logging excludes pre-consent identifiers. Each environment's enforced configuration appears below.

config for hawep-taweg:
[frair]
port = 8443
region = west-3
host = frair.sivrelhq.internal
team = oliael
timeout_ms = 1000
retries = 2

Hi all — quick recap for department heads before Thursday's session. The Greywater region carried the quarter again, with the Pinefort branch up 14 percent on strong Bramblelight orders. The Southmoor corridor, though, slipped for the second straight quarter, and we'll want a proper conversation about coverage there rather than another band-aid. Marketing's new campaign helped, but conversion lagged in rural accounts. Bring your own numbers and keep commentary short. The confidential plan summary sits just below this note.

internal memo for fajog-yagaf: Gross margin on Ulaael came in at 20 percent against a plan of 10 percent. Only 9 of the 80 pilot accounts renewed Ulaael, so a churn review is set for July 1.

Handover note — Crumbwheel order cutoffs.

Welcome aboard. The bakery cutoff rule in Crumbwheel closes same-day orders at 14:00 local to each storefront, not UTC — this has bitten us twice. Holiday overrides live in the calendar service and take precedence silently, so always check there first when a cutoff looks wrong. To unlock the calendar service's admin console after a restart, enter the recovery passphrase below.

vault phrase of bagap-bahaf = silion-pelox-sorox-casdor-quenwyn-fraax-eliox-praael-kelion-quenvan-kasox-rusael-norius-belvan